Understanding application and longevity
Application technique matters when dealing with attars. A small amount, dabbed on pulse points or blended with a fragrance-neutral oil, tends to yield the most refined experience. The longevity of an Attar Perfume is often impressive, with notes that evolve from bright top layers to richer, lingering bases. Because these oils are made without alcohol, projection is intimate. This makes attars ideal for those who prefer a scent that enhances rather than announces their presence, offering a subtle and enduring aura throughout the day.

Care tips and storage for lasting scent
To preserve the integrity of Attar Perfume, store tightly sealed bottles in a cool, dark place away from direct sunlight. Exposure to heat can alter the balance of essential oils, reducing vibrancy over time. Use clean applicators to prevent contamination and avoid frequent exposure to air, which can degrade aromatic compounds. Regularly inspecting bottles helps ensure the oil remains fresh and potent. With proper care, attars maintain their character, inviting you to revisit a familiar scent that consistently meets expectations across seasons.
